How they compare
Bangladesh currently reports 33.3% against 21.3% in Europe & Central Asia, a difference of 12.0%.
That makes Bangladesh's figure about 1.6 times Europe & Central Asia's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 12 shared years of data; in 1993 it was Europe & Central Asia ahead.
Bangladesh ranks 14th and Europe & Central Asia ranks 14th of 160 countries.
Europe & Central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bangladesh | Europe & Central Asia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 8.5% | 18.7% | 10.2% | Europe & Central Asia |
| 2000s | 11.6% | 21.4% | 9.7% | Europe & Central Asia |
| 2010s | 19.4% | 22.2% | 2.7% | Europe & Central Asia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Expenditure on tertiary education is expressed as a percentage of total general government expenditure on education. General government usually refers to local, regional and central governments.
